Output 7aa50bd6560a31fc4ac128f970fb48d8d020d9a40450593a00bf785cd4e27425:31

value
151970069
script pubkey
OP_0 OP_PUSHBYTES_32 4293c2d3b99c767f123a9aa4c056cfcb5bd83e684c28fa18c37bfe15703ee3f3
address
bc1qg2fu95aen3m87y36n2jvq4k0eddas0ngfs505xxr00lp2up7u0es5823vu
transaction
7aa50bd6560a31fc4ac128f970fb48d8d020d9a40450593a00bf785cd4e27425
spent
true